IAR Systems introduces complete integrated development suite for ColdFire® microcontrollers
IAR Systems, the market leader in tools for 32-bit MCUs, strengthens its portfolio by introducing a complete development suite for Freescale ColdFire MCU architecture
IAR YellowSuite™ for ColdFire® microcontrollers promotes a natural design flow from the beginning of a development project, integrating all the necessary tools to produce a working design in the shortest possible time. The development tools included in IAR YellowSuite for ColdFire microcontrollers comprise: IAR Embedded Workbench®, for building and debugging the application; IAR visualSTATE®, for design, validation, test and verification of the control logic; IAR PowerPac™ RTOS, file system and associated middleware; and an IAR KickStart Kit™, to test the application on real hardware.

IAR Embedded Workbench, with support for ColdFire V1 and V2 cores, is a set of highly sophisticated and easy-to-use development tools – C/C++ compiler, assembler, linker, librarian, text editor, project manager, and debugger – combined in an integrated development environment (IDE) for programming embedded applications. With its built-in chip-specific code optimizer, IAR Embedded Workbench generates very efficient and reliable FLASH/PROMable code for ColdFire devices.
IAR visualSTATE is a set of powerful graphical development tools for designing, testing and implementing embedded applications based on state machines and on the Unified Modeling Language (UML) subset. It provides advanced verification and validation utilities, and generates very compact C code that is 100% consistent with the system design. visualSTATE features RTOS-aware debugging, with a built-in plugin for IAR PowerPac.
IAR PowerPac is an integrated middleware toolset for developing embedded applications, with a low-risk per-seat license model. IAR PowerPac contains a fully featured real-time operating system (RTOS) and a high-performance file system, which is highly optimized for minimum memory consumption in both RAM and ROM. A USB device stack is available as optional add-on to IAR PowerPac.
The IAR KickStart Kit for ColdFire will be introduced later in October, and contains all the necessary hardware, software and ready-made example projects to allow the cost-effective design, development, integration and test of applications in a very efficient way.
About IAR Systems
IAR Systems is a world-leading provider of embedded development tools:
IAR Embedded Workbench® — integrated development environment with C/C++ compiler and debugger supporting about 30 different 8 , 16-, and 32-bit devices.
visualSTATE® — state chart design tool for development of event-driven systems.
IAR KickStart Kit™ — complete software and hardware evaluation environment available for selected targets
IAR Advanced Development Kit™ — integrated suite containing all the necessary components for full product development
IAR PowerPac™ — a fully-featured real-time operating system (RTOS) combined with a high performance file system
IAR Systems customers represent many different market segments such as telecommunications, industrial automation and the automotive industry. The company was founded in 1983 and is part of the Nocom Group since 2005. IAR Systems operates in the US, China, Japan, Germany, the UK, Sweden and Brazil as well as through a large net of distributors all over the world.
